Thule Tracrac 29610XT Instructions

To install the Thule TracRac 29610XT, first ensure that your truck bed is clean and free of debris. Then, follow the detailed installation instructions provided in the user manual, which includes assembling the rack components, positioning them on your truck bed, and securing them using the supplied clamps and bolts. Always double-check that all parts are tightly secured before use.
The Thule TracRac 29610XT has a maximum load capacity of 1,250 lbs, making it suitable for carrying heavy equipment and materials. Ensure that you do not exceed this weight limit to maintain safety and performance.
Regular maintenance of the Thule TracRac 29610XT involves cleaning the rack with mild soap and water to prevent corrosion and checking all bolts and clamps for tightness to ensure safety. Lubricate moving parts occasionally to keep them functioning smoothly.
The Thule TracRac 29610XT is compatible with certain tonneau covers designed to work with truck racks. Verify compatibility with the tonneau cover manufacturer or consult the Thule website for specific models that can be used together.
If you experience vibrations or noise, check that all components are securely fastened. Tighten any loose bolts or clamps, and ensure that the load is evenly distributed. Adding rubber pads to contact points can also help dampen vibrations.
To adjust the height of the Thule TracRac 29610XT, loosen the adjustment knobs located on the uprights. Slide the uprights to the desired height, and then retighten the knobs securely to lock the rack in place.

The Thule TracRac 29610XT is constructed from high-quality aluminum, which is both lightweight and corrosion-resistant, ensuring durability and long-term performance under various weather conditions.

During regular inspections, check for any signs of wear or damage, ensure all bolts and clamps are tight, and confirm that the rack is securely mounted to the truck. Inspect the integrity of the load bars and uprights, and address any issues promptly.
